Tormach machinist Mike Corliss demonstrates the basic setup procedure for using a Tormach Boring Head to bore out the inner diameter of a hole. The boring head can be dial adjusted to bore both large or small diameters as well as oddball sizes. At 3:47, a telescoping gauge is used to measure the inner diameter of the hole.
